The book ""Life and Campaigns of George B. McClellan Major-General U.S. Army"" by G.S. Hillard is a detailed biography of the famous American Civil War general, George Brinton McClellan. The book provides a comprehensive overview of McClellan's life, from his early years as a student at the United States Military Academy at West Point, to his rise through the ranks of the U.S. Army, and ultimately to his role as a major general during the Civil War.The author, G.S. Hillard, was a close friend and political ally of McClellan, and his book is based on extensive research and personal knowledge of the general. Hillard provides a detailed account of McClellan's military campaigns, including his successes and failures, as well as his relationships with other generals and political figures of the time.The book also delves into McClellan's personal life, including his marriage and family, and his political ambitions. Hillard provides insight into McClellan's personality, his strengths and weaknesses as a leader, and his impact on the course of the Civil War.Overall, ""Life and Campaigns of George B.
